Deeg, Wright Notch Top-20 Finishes

Wolcott, Colo. - Katelyn Wright and Cassie Deeg tied for 20th in a talented 18-team field to lead the Nebraska women's golf team at the Golfweek Conference Challenge at the Red Sky Golf Club on Wednesday.

Wright and Deeg each produced 54-hole totals of 222 to lead Nebraska to a 15th-place team finish at 924.

Wright produced her third consecutive solid round with a three-over-par 75 on the 6,236-yard, par-72 layout of the Fazio Course at Red Sky. Her three-round total was nine strokes better than the season-opening 231 she produced to tie for 11th at Nebraska's Chip-N Club Invitational two weeks ago. Wright has posted six consecutive rounds better than 80 to open the season, including five rounds of 76 or better.

The junior from Incline Village, Nev., has been striving for consistency in her game and showed it in all three rounds against a loaded 18-team tournament field that included nine ranked teams. In shooting her 75 Wednesday, Wright produced 12 consecutive pars. For the tournament, she did not settle for a double-bogey, while managing five birdies, 38 pars and 11 bogeys over 54 holes.

Deeg, a true freshman from Hugo, Minn., added a solid final round with a 77. Deeg's 222 eclipsed her total at NU's season-opening Chip-N Club Invite, Sept. 10-11 at the Country Club of Lincoln by 21 strokes. Her three-round total of 222 included a career-best 69 in Monday's first round.

Lincoln native Jackie O'Doherty carded her second straight solid round for the Huskers with a 79 Wednesday. The redshirt freshman out of Lincoln East High School finished in 87th with a 252, but produced rounds of 78 and 79 on the final two days of the tournament.

Fellow redshirt freshman Morgan Smejkal from Columbus, Neb., posted NU's fourth-best score of the round with an 83 to finish with a 54-hole total of 256.

Junior Steffi Neisen rounded out the Husker contingent with an 86 to tie for 74th at 242.

Pepperdine won the team title with a three-round score of 860 that included a final-round 285. UC Davis took runner-up honors with an 865 after firing an even-par 288 in the third round. Oklahoma finished third at 881.

UC Davis' Demi Runas earned medalist honors with a seven-under-par 209 over 54 holes. Runas closed the tournament with a one-under 71 on Wednesday after producing rounds of 71 and 67 through the first 36 holes.

Pepperdine's Grace Na and Texas-San Antonio's Fabiola Arriaga tied for second at 212.
